Start with a draft copy version of each cross-mapped diagram file. Make sure it is organized into 5 layers as follows: white, black, extension-white, extension-black, format. Make a new model file, then using paste from drafting, transfer a copy of the draft layers to the model file. Extrude figures, and use the section tool to cut volumes according to extension lines. Create new layers: iso-white; iso-black; iso-ext white; iso-ext black; iso-format.
Major Tools: layers; paste from drafting (edit); 3D extrusion (derivatives); section (booleans); isometric (views; view parameters)
Output: for each cross-mapped diagram set, turn on all layers in the 3D model file; render 45-degree isometric wire-frame; export image to Illustrator; open in Illustrator; re-save.
